LUCY "The Space” Family Support Idea for the Week:     

Holiday Survival Guide 

Breaks from school can actually feel quite stressful for children, especially with all the disruption to the start of the year and their regular schedules and routines are again disrupted. As we head into a longer holiday, here are some tips on how to minimise the tears and maximise the joy at home. 

How can parents help? 

As always with parenting, it is most important to look after yourself first. Make sure your own cup isn’t full so you can stay calm. You can also let them know in advance what they will be doing over the holiday and remind them again every morning the plans for that day. Many children will also do better if you keep to some routine and schedule every day, to offer them some predictability. If you can, always include some outdoor or physical activity every day as it helps them to stay regulated. Finally, remember to do less and connect more!
